
在Excel表中计算年平均工资的方法有多种,包括使用基本公式、函数、数据透视表等。、其中一种常用的方法是使用AVERAGE函数。下面将详细讲解如何在Excel表中计算年平均工资,并介绍几种不同的方法来处理这个任务。
一、使用AVERAGE函数
1.1 了解AVERAGE函数
AVERAGE函数是Excel中最简单且最常用的函数之一。它用于计算一组数据的平均值。语法为:=AVERAGE(number1, [number2], ...),其中number1、number2等是要计算平均值的数字或单元格范围。
1.2 应用AVERAGE函数计算年平均工资
假设你有一列数据是员工每个月的工资,存储在A列,从A2到A13(A1为标题行)。你可以在B1单元格中输入以下公式来计算年平均工资:
=AVERAGE(A2:A13)
这个公式会计算A2到A13单元格中所有数值的平均值,即年平均工资。如果你的工资数据在其他列或范围,只需调整公式中的单元格范围即可。
二、使用SUM和COUNT函数
2.1 了解SUM和COUNT函数
除了AVERAGE函数,你还可以使用SUM和COUNT函数来计算平均工资。SUM函数用于求和,COUNT函数用于计数。语法如下:
=SUM(number1, [number2], ...)=COUNT(value1, [value2], ...)
2.2 应用SUM和COUNT函数计算年平均工资
在B1单元格中输入以下公式:
=SUM(A2:A13)/COUNT(A2:A13)
这个公式先求A2到A13单元格中所有数值的和,然后除以这些单元格的数量,从而得到年平均工资。这种方法与使用AVERAGE函数达到的结果是一样的,但它更直观地展示了计算平均值的过程。
三、使用数据透视表
3.1 数据透视表的优点
数据透视表是Excel中强大的工具,特别适用于数据量大且需要多维度分析的情况。它不仅可以计算平均值,还能进行更复杂的数据统计和分析。
3.2 创建数据透视表
- 选择你的数据范围(例如A1:A13)。
- 点击“插入”选项卡,然后选择“数据透视表”。
- 在弹出的对话框中,选择数据源和目标位置(可以是新工作表或现有工作表)。
- 在数据透视表字段列表中,拖动“工资”字段到“值”区域。
- 点击“值”的下拉菜单,选择“值字段设置”,然后选择“平均值”。
这样,数据透视表将显示所有工资数据的平均值,即年平均工资。
四、处理缺失数据
4.1 识别和处理缺失数据
在实际操作中,有时会遇到缺失数据(即某些单元格为空)。在计算年平均工资时,处理这些缺失数据非常重要。你可以使用IF函数或IFERROR函数来处理缺失数据。
4.2 使用IF函数处理缺失数据
假设你的工资数据在A2到A13单元格中,可以使用以下公式来忽略空单元格:
=AVERAGEIF(A2:A13, "<>")
这个公式会计算A2到A13单元格中非空单元格的平均值。
4.3 使用IFERROR函数处理错误数据
如果你的数据中可能包含错误值(例如除以零错误),可以使用IFERROR函数来处理:
=IFERROR(AVERAGE(A2:A13), 0)
这个公式会在计算过程中遇到错误时返回0,而不是显示错误信息。
五、处理异常值
5.1 识别和处理异常值
在计算平均工资时,有时可能会遇到异常值(即极端高或低的工资数据)。这些异常值可能会影响平均值的准确性。你可以使用TRIMMEAN函数来处理异常值。
5.2 使用TRIMMEAN函数
TRIMMEAN函数用于计算排除指定比例的高低值后的平均值。语法为:=TRIMMEAN(array, percent),其中array是数据范围,percent是要排除的高低值比例。
假设你的工资数据在A2到A13单元格中,可以使用以下公式来排除最高和最低的5%数据:
=TRIMMEAN(A2:A13, 0.1)
这个公式会排除最高和最低各5%的数据,然后计算剩余数据的平均值。
六、动态更新年平均工资
6.1 使用表格功能
在Excel中,将数据转换为表格可以使公式自动扩展,从而动态更新年平均工资。选择数据范围(例如A1:A13),然后点击“插入”选项卡,选择“表格”。这样,当你在表格中添加新数据时,平均工资的公式会自动更新。
6.2 使用动态数组公式
如果你使用的是Excel 365或Excel 2019,可以使用动态数组公式来动态更新年平均工资。假设你的工资数据在A2到A13单元格中,可以使用以下公式:
=AVERAGE(A2:INDEX(A:A, COUNTA(A:A)))
这个公式会根据数据的实际范围动态计算平均工资。
七、总结
在Excel表中计算年平均工资的方法有多种,包括使用AVERAGE函数、SUM和COUNT函数、数据透视表等。每种方法都有其优点和适用场景。使用AVERAGE函数是最简单的方法,适用于数据量较小且格式规范的情况。使用SUM和COUNT函数可以更直观地展示计算过程。数据透视表则适用于数据量大且需要多维度分析的情况。同时,在实际操作中,还需要处理缺失数据和异常值,并确保公式能够动态更新。通过掌握这些方法和技巧,你可以在Excel中高效地计算年平均工资,满足不同场景下的需求。
相关问答FAQs:
1. 如何在Excel表中计算年平均工资?
在Excel表中计算年平均工资可以通过以下步骤进行:
- 首先,在一个列中输入每个月的工资数据。
- 其次,选中一空白单元格,使用函数
AVERAGE计算出所有月份的平均工资。例如,AVERAGE(A1:A12)表示计算A1到A12单元格的平均值。 - 接下来,将计算出的平均工资乘以12,得到年平均工资。例如,如果平均工资为1000美元,那么年平均工资就是1000 * 12 = 12000美元。
2. Excel表中如何计算年平均工资并考虑到部分月份的工资缺失?
如果在Excel表中有部分月份的工资缺失,可以使用以下步骤计算年平均工资:
- 首先,在一个列中输入每个月的工资数据,对于缺失的月份,可以使用0或者其他符合实际情况的数值进行填充。
- 其次,选中一空白单元格,使用函数
AVERAGEIF计算出所有非零月份的平均工资。例如,AVERAGEIF(A1:A12,">0")表示计算A1到A12单元格中大于0的数值的平均值。 - 接下来,将计算出的平均工资乘以12,得到年平均工资。
3. 如何在Excel表中计算某个时间段内的年平均工资?
如果想要计算某个时间段内的年平均工资,可以按照以下步骤进行:
- 首先,在一个列中输入每个月的工资数据。
- 其次,选中一空白单元格,使用函数
AVERAGEIFS计算出时间段内的平均工资。例如,AVERAGEIFS(A1:A12,B1:B12,">=起始日期",B1:B12,"<=结束日期")表示计算A1到A12单元格中,对应的B列日期在起始日期和结束日期之间的工资的平均值。 - 接下来,将计算出的平均工资乘以12,得到时间段内的年平均工资。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5018611